Hi' How I Can Enable Virtualization Take You

Please enter BIOS setup and go to OverClocking => CPU Features => SVM to activate Virtualization. You can enter BIOS Setup by pressing the delete key while the computer is booting up. If this does not work, try the F2 key also, as this depend on the model of your MSI.
